Chapter 6
Power and Power-Up Modes
The computer's power resources include the computer, wireless keyboard
and wireless mouse. The computer is supplied with the AC adapter while
the wireless keyboard and mouse are supplied with AA batteries. This
chapter provides details on making the most effective use of these
resources.
Monitoring of power condition
As shown in the below table, the Power indicator on the system indicator
alerts you to the computer’s operating capability.
Power indicator
Check the Power indicator to determine the power status of the computer -
the following indicator conditions should be noted:
White Indicates power is being supplied to the computer
and the computer is turned on.
Blinking amber Indicates that the computer is in Sleep Mode and
that there is sufficient power available to maintain
this condition. In Sleep Mode, this indicator will
turn on for two seconds and off for two seconds.
No light Under any other conditions, the indicator does not
light.
